    Getting There

    Car

    If you are driving from the center of Sunshine Coast, head north on Nicklin Way. Continue on Nicklin Way for about 15 minutes. As you approach Kings Beach, take a left onto Beech Street, then take the first right onto Memorial Lane. Anzac Park will be on your left at 7 Memorial Lane, Kings Beach QLD 4551. Parking is available along the street or in nearby parking lots, which may incur a fee. Check local signage for parking rules.

    Public Transportation

    To get to Anzac Park using public transportation, you can catch a bus from various locations within the Sunshine Coast. Look for a bus heading towards Caloundra and get off at the Kings Beach stop. From there, walk towards Memorial Lane, which is approximately a 10-minute walk. Head east on Ormonde Terrace, then turn right onto Memorial Lane. Anzac Park will be located at 7 Memorial Lane, Kings Beach QLD 4551. Note that bus fares vary depending on your starting location, so check the local transport website for specific costs.

    Taxi/Rideshare

    If you prefer a more direct route, consider using a taxi or rideshare service like Uber. Simply input '7 Memorial Ln, Kings Beach QLD 4551' as your destination. The fare will depend on your current location within Sunshine Coast and the time of day, with typical fares ranging from $15 to $30. This is a convenient option if you are traveling with luggage or prefer a hassle-free journey.

    Discover more about Anzac Park

    Anzac Park, located in the scenic Kings Beach area of Queensland, is a beautifully maintained memorial park that serves as a tribute to the sacrifices made by Australian soldiers. Visitors will be captivated by the park's serene atmosphere, lush gardens, and breathtaking views of the coastline. The park is adorned with various memorials and plaques that commemorate the bravery of those who served, making it a poignant spot for reflection and remembrance. The gentle sound of waves crashing against the shore adds to the peaceful ambiance, inviting visitors to take a moment to pause and appreciate the significance of this location. As you stroll through the park, you will find well-manicured lawns and shaded seating areas, perfect for a picnic or simply enjoying the natural beauty surrounding you. Whether you are visiting solo, with family, or friends, Anzac Park offers a tranquil escape from the hustle and bustle of everyday life. The park is also a popular spot for whale watching during migration seasons, providing a unique opportunity to witness these majestic creatures in their natural habitat. Anzac Park is not just a memorial; it is a vibrant community space where locals and tourists alike can come together to appreciate the significance of the past while enjoying the stunning coastal views. It's an ideal destination for those looking to combine history with leisure, making it a must-visit when in Kings Beach.
